PETROLEO BRASILEIRO S.A.-PETROBRAS ADS (REP 1 COMMON SHARE) earnings per share and revenue

On Nov 05, 2025, PBR reported earnings of 2.23 USD per share (EPS) for Q3 25, beating the estimate of 1.86 USD, resulting in a 19.80% surprise. Revenue reached 127.92 billion, compared to an expected 133.79 billion, with a -4.39% difference. The market reacted with a 0.00% price change (close before vs. close after earnings).
Looking ahead to Q4 25, 7 analysts forecast an EPS of 1.65 USD, with revenue projected to reach 123.77 billion USD, implying an decrease of -26.01% EPS, and decrease of -3.24% in Revenue from the last quarter.
